Solskjaer: MU Besar karena Matt Busby

MANCHESTER, KOMPAS.com - Mantan pemain Manchester United, Ole Gunnar Solskjaer, mengungkapkan bahwa MU bisa seperti sekarang karena peran besar dari Sir Matt Busby. Pelatih legendaris MU itulah yang mengawali upaya MU membina para pemain muda.

Di mata Solskjaer, Busby bukan sekadar pelatih yang sukses membawa MU ke kejuaraan Eropa apda 1968. Keyakinan Busby terhadap talenta pemain-pemain muda membuat tradisi mencetak pemain akademi di MU berjalan terus hingga kepelatihan Sir Alex Ferguson.

"Sir Matt selalu percaya pada pemberian kesempatan kepada pemain muda. Itu peran besarnya dan salah satu yang diteruskan oleh Sir Alex," kata Solksjaer, yang kini dipercaya melatih tim bayangan "Setan Merah".

Solskjaer mengakui, ketika pertama kali datang ke Old Trafford pada 1996, ia belajar banyak tentang sejarah klub tersebut. Ia mempelajarinya dari mendiang Busby, yang meninggal dunia dua tahun sebelumnya. Solskjaer pun pun tak segan bertanya kepada putra Busby, Sandy, untuk menyelami seperti apa sebenarnya kiprah "Setan Merah" sebelum ia datang.

"Manchester United berutang banyak kepadanya. Sir Matt-lah yang memberikan arah dan visi untuk membawa klub ke Eropa ketika tak seorang pun melakukannya," tambah pencetak gol kemenangan MU di final Liga Champions 1999 itu.

Kini tugas membina pemain muda MU ada di pundak Solskjaer. Di tangannya, bakal lahir pemuda-pemuda berprestasi dari akademi "Setan Merah". "Aku merasa tersanjung menjadi bagian dari itu. Pemain muda di Manchester United tahu jika mereka cukup bagus mereka akan mendapat peluang," ujarnya.

Liga Inggris kini menjadi sorotan menyusul sanksi yang bakal dihadapi Chelsea atas kasus perekrutan pemain muda Gael Kakuta. MU juga bakal menghadapi ancaman serupa setelah Le Havre menuntut mereka atas rekrutmen Paul Pogba. (AP)

Ole Gunnar Solskjaer tipped for a return to Norway as new boss of Rosenborg
By ASHLEY GRAY
Last updated at 7:35 PM on 03rd November 2009


Ole Gunnar Solskjaer is being lined up to be the next manager of Norwegian side Rosenborg. The former Manchester United striker is currently the reserve team boss at Old Trafford.

Rosenborg boss Eric Hamren is the frontrunner to take over as head coach of the Sweden national team and has already been interviewed for the position, leaving the Norwegian champions to make contingency plans.


Pointing the way: Ole Gunnar Solskjaer is currently in charge of the Manchester United reserve team

Solskjaer is so highly regarded in his home country that he was offered the chance to manager his country earlier this year. He has again been consulted on who he thinks should land the Norway job, though it is thought the 36-year-old is not in the running for that role.

Solskjaer's adviser Jim Solbakken said: 'It is only natural that the Norwegian club would check out Ole Gunnar’s situation. He will not be reserve team coach at Manchester United for the rest of his life.'

Solskjaer Bakal Latih Rosenborg?
Doni Wahyudi - detiksport


ist.
Manchester - Karir kepelatihan Ole Gunnar Solskjaer akan berlanjut ke tingkat yang lebih tinggi lagi. Dia dikabarkan bakal pulang kampung karena diminta melatih Rosenborg.

Setelah memutuskan pensiun pada tahun 2007 lalu Solskjaer memang mulai menekuni karir baru sebagai pelatih. Saat itu dia langsung ditunjuk Sir Alex Ferguson sebagai pelatih striker di tim pertama "Setan Merah".

Di musim panas tahun 2008, Solskjaer dapat posisi baru setelah ditunjuk jadi pelatih tim reserve MU. Dia sukses mengantar anak asuhnya memenangi Lancashire Senior Cup dengan mengalahkan tim reserves Liverpool dengan 3–2.

Meski masih belum punya banyak pengalaman, mantan striker internasional Norwegia itu ternyata sudah punya peminat. Klub yang ingin memakai jasa pria 36 itu adalah sang juara Liga Utama Norwegia Rosenborg, demikian diberitakan Dailymail.

Posisi pelatih Rosenborg diyakini akan kosong dalam waktu dekat karena pemilik jabatan tersebut, Eric Hamren, sudah ditawari jabatan untuk membesut timnas Norwegia. Saat ini Hamren sudah menjalani wawancara dengan Asosiasi Sepakbola Norwegia untuk menjadi bos John Arne Riise dkk.

Menurut keterangan seorang wakil Solskjaer, menerima pinangan Rosenborg bukanlah sesuatu yang tak mungkin. Soalnya mantan pemain The Red Devils di era 1996-2007 itu tak mungkin selamanya menjadi pelatih tim reserve.

"Itu sesuatu yang normal jika ada klub Norwegia mencari tahu situasi Ole Gunnar. Dia tak akan menjadi pelatih tim reserve di Manchester United sepanjang hidupnya," sahut jusrubicara Solskjaer, Jim Solbakken.

Rosenborg bukan satu-satunya tim yang berniat menjadikan Solskjaer sebagai pelatih. Beberapa waktu lalu timnas Norwegia bahkan sempat melamar Solskjaer, meski kemudian ditolak karena dia menganggap belum pantas membesut timnas.

Manchester United Hall Of Fame: Ole Gunnar Solskjaer



You would be hard pressed to find a Man United fan that does not Ole Gunnar Solskjaer.

As well as being a great goal scorer, a trophy winner and a model professional the ‘Baby Faced Assassin’ was a class act. When he was awarded with the Royal Norwegian order of St.Olav First Class, Egil Vindorum, head of the Oslo place chancellery, explained,

“What is being honoured are his attitudes, his way of being. He is a role model for children and young people, what he did on the soccer field has nothing to do with it. We’ll leave that to others, like the Norwegian Football Federation.”

And this is a testament to the character of the Manchester United legend.

Never did he moan or complain about being on the bench rather he worked hard and when the opportunity presented itself he grabbed it with both hands. He was self less and always put the needs of United ahead of himself.

In 1998, United were losing their grip on the League and in a game against Newcastle he was thrown on late in order to try and grab a win as 1-1 was not good enough. David Beckham, who had scored United’s equaliser, played a ball into the box but Newcastle cleared quicker than expected. As Rob Lee bore down on goal, Solskjaer sacrificed himself and swiped Rob Lee’s standing leg. The danger had been averted but Solskjaer would have to be punished receiving a straight red card for his intentional foul. As he left the field he received a standing ovation from the Stretford End, they fully appreciated the sacrifice he had just made to keep their title dream alive.


Signed from FK Molde after United missed out on Alan Shearer, Solskjaer would hit 18 goals in his first season helping United secure the title in the last week of the 1996-1997 season. He would go on to acquire the tag super sub after coming off the bench numerous times to score and famously got 4 goals in 12 minutes as United beat Nottingham Forest 8-1 (He would score 4 goals in a single game again later that season in a 5-1 victory over Everton).


As memorable as that match was his finest moment came in the 1999 Champions League final against Bayern Munich. United had looked dead and buried but Solskjaer was introdcued in the 81st minute to see if he could change the game around. In extra time Teddy Sherringham grabbed an equaliser to make it 1-1 and with another corner United packed the box as they went for the kill against a shaken Bayern side. Beckham’s corner was knocked on by Teddy Sherringham only for Ole to put it into the net and win the Champions League for United, at the same time cementing his place in United history.


Solskjaer was way more than just a super sub and the fact that he started 217 of his 367 matches proves this. Injury hampered his career and with United signing Ruud Van Nistelrooy, preferring to play with a lone striker, he moved to right wing in place of an injured David Beckham where he also shone.

So much in fact that Beckham failed to dislodge him when he returned to fitness and that coupled with a falling out with Sir Alex Ferguson spelled the end of the superstar’s Old Trafford career as he moved to Real Madrid.

Solskjaer brought the curtain down on his playing career in 2007 scoring his 128th and final goal against Blackburn in a 4-1 United win.

But this was not the end of his career at Old Trafford as he would go on to take up an ambassador’s role at the club in the summer of the same year and is now manager of the reserve side where it is hoped he can impart on the younger players of this flashy generation the humility that he showed throughout his career.

When he received his award in his home town of Kristiansund, the mayor Dagfinn Ripnes, stated:

“Many in his position become playboys and suffer symptoms from being a star,” he said. “Ole Gunnar remained the same down-to-earth, good guy.”

And its because of this, as well as the goals that Ole is and forever will be loved by United fans.

Don't give up - Solskjaer



Ole Solskjaer insists United's attacking firepower is still red hot - both short term and looking further into the future.

The Reds' 1999 European Cup winning goal hero will link up with two more of the famous Treble-winning front quartet in United's Big Red Family Day Out at Old Trafford on May 1. Solskjaer will be on duty for an All-Star United line-up with his '99 goal buddies Dwight Yorke and Andrew Cole.

More than a decade ago that trio, with Teddy Sheringham, formed the innovative four-strong senior strike-force that helped lay the ground for the historic all-conquering treble success.

But this term injuries have ravaged Sir Alex Ferguson's attacking department.

The ultimate blow came with Wayne Rooney's ill-timed ankle injury that has put a spanner in United's European and Premier League double bid.

Saturday's lunchtime derby against City at Eastlands looks set to be the last chance saloon for the Reds in the title battle.

But Solskjaer says United must get their chins up.

"We cannot afford for it all to be doom and gloom. We are still in with a shout," says the Norwegian who is now United's reserve team manager.

"A derby match against City is the perfect platform for the boys to bounce back. Playing your local rivals is not a time for feeling sorry for yourselves and I don't think we will be.

"There is no doubt Chelsea are in the box seat but you have to be in there in case of slip ups.

"I can only recall one title race we won in 2001 when it was all very comfortable. The tradition is to make it hard for ourselves but while you are fighting it is not cut and dried."

City and Chelsea have been the in-form Premier League goalscorers in Spring.

But Solskjaer says the quality is still at Old Trafford.

"Of course the quality is there," Ole told M.E.N. Sport.

Excuses

"The problem has been injuries. I don't want to make excuses but it has hit us hard in recent months up front.

"The great thing about 1999 was that apart from Teddy Sheringham suffering a few injuries in that season, the manager had myself, Dwight and Andy to call on for virtually the full campaign. It makes a difference."

Sir Alex Ferguson's young back-up attack has also been ravaged by injuries.

Italian 19-year-old Federico Macheda has only just returned after a four-month spell out with a groin injury.

Mancunian Danny Welbeck was forced to return from a educating loan spell at Preston when the 19-year-old suffered a knee injury.

Mame Biram Diouf, has also succumbed to a groin problem.

"It has been disappointing they've all had their injury problems," says Ole. "But they are young and exciting and they have got the chance of a lifetime here at United.

"They have got an opportunity to play for Manchester United for many years to come. I wish I was still in that situation.

"If I was I'd be out working long afternoons and practising my heading and shooting. They are all developing talents.

"To steal a march they have to work hard and they will. Diouf has pace, Macheda is quick, powerful and the most natural finisher and Welbeck is an all-round striker.

"It has been disappointing that their progress has been hampered by injury but, hopefully, next season they will be fit and ready to prove they should be the one challenging."

Fergie has also added the unknown talent of 21-year-old Mexican goalscorer Javier Hernandez to his pool for next term.

"I have never seen him live but the TV clips are impressive," added Solskjaer. "I always think it is very exciting when the club buys someone nobody has really heard of. I am looking forward to seeing him."

Fergie Bangga Solskjaer Bawa MU Muda Juara



VIVAnews - Manajer Manchester United Sir Alex Ferguson mengucapkan selamat pada mantan anak asuhnya, Ole Gunnar Solskjaer, karena membawa tim Reserve MU juara di Barclays Premier Reserve League North. Selasa malam 20 April 2010, para Setan Muda memastikan diri jadi juara kompetisi tim Junior itu setelah menekuk Everton.

Buat Solskjaer ini adalah gelar pertamanya sejak ditunjuk sebagai manajer tim muda MU dua tahun lalu. Mantan winger Setan Merah ini bekerjasama dengan pelatih berpengalaman, Warren Joyce, untuk membawa satu tambahan trophy ke Manchester.

"Saya ingin mengucapkan selamat untuk Ole dan Warren. Mereka melakukan pekerjaan dengan baik," kata Fergie -sapaan Ferguson- dikutip dari situs resmi MU, Kamis 22 April 2010.

"Tiap kali kami menunjuk pelatih tim muda, saya selalu menjelaskan ke mereka betapa sulitnya pekerjaan itu," jelas sang manajer lagi.

Kemenangan tim muda MU ini juga menjadi 'tiket' bagi para pengisi skuadnya. Sebab, itu artinya ada peluang untuk 'promosi' ke tim senior dan berlaga bersama pemain bernama besar. Seperti Wayne Rooney, Dimitar Berbatov, serta para veteran 'Kelas 92' --Gary Neville dan Paul Scholes.

Sebaliknya buat Solskjaer ini menjadi kesuksesan baru dalam rekam jejaknya di dunia sepakbola. Bersama MU di pertengaham 90'an hingga 2007, pria berjuluk 'Baby Face' ini menyumbang enam gelar Premier League dan satu titel Liga Champions. Keputusannya untuk gantung sepatu sebagai pemain terjadi karena cedera yang tak kunjung pulih seratus persen.(irv)

Man Utd coach Solskjaer delighted to win reserve title at first attempt
-tribalfootball.com-



Manchester United reserves coach Ole Gunnar Solskjaer admits he's delighted to have won the northern title in his first season.

It was the first time United's kids have been crowned champions since 2006.

"I am proud and it is very satisfying, but this isn't for me it is for the young players who have worked very, very hard," Solskjaer told the Manchester Evening News. "They are a brilliant group of lads. They have been a pleasure to work with.

"There is a big turnover of players and that makes it hard to get consistency and difficult to work every day on team shape.

"But there is a core group of about eight to 10 players who have been there all the time and their attitude has been great and work rate phenomenal. They deserve the success they've had."

Lifting silverware is part of the Manchester United experience and an aspect of development Solskjaer and Warren Joyce have been focused on.

"The reserves is all about producing players for the gaffer and getting them used to winning, playing in the right way and getting used to the expectations at United," added Solskjaer. "We've always prided ourselves on the way we play. They've won the league and won it themselves. They deserve the praise."

In true United fashion, a doctrine instilled in Champions League goal-scoring hero and six-times Premier League title winner Solskjaer by Sir Alex Ferguson, it's job done, now for the next one.

"The title's won now and we must move on.

"That's what it is all about. It's the name of the game," he says.
